Ticket PICKROUTE-441: The Korvane vault holding signing material for PickPath, our warehouse pick-list optimizer, locked itself after three failed unseal attempts during the plugin SDK release. External plugin authors cannot fetch route manifests until it is reopened. Per the Harlowe Logistics recovery procedure, the passphrase for the unseal ceremony is listed below.

recovery phrase for bawef-haduf: wenax-druox-julmir

## Deployment notes: spreadsheet export

Hey — before you sign off, one thing worth flagging. The Fernwhistle export service builds spreadsheets entirely in memory, so a big tenant export can balloon the pod past its limit and trigger OOM kills. We've moved to streaming row-by-row writes, which caps memory at roughly 150 MB regardless of export size. No user data is buffered to disk, which should make your review easier. The streaming behavior is controlled by the settings below, which ship as defaults in every environment.

service settings:
PRAIX_LOG_LEVEL=error
PRAIX_METRICS_HOST=metrics.praix.qorvelcorp.corp
PRAIX_POOL_SIZE=16

# Haulpoint driver-assignment heuristic config.
# Scoring: distance weight 0.6, acceptance-rate weight 0.3, idle-time 0.1.
# Tune weights below; keep them summing to 1.0 or the ranker normalizes
# and logs a warning. Reassignment window is 90s, hard-coded for now.
# The scoring service calls the geo-index, which needs its API secret
# set on the next line.

vault entry, yahif-yajep: COURIER_KEY29=b802bdf8034096b65a51c6ba5abe2